Specifications

  • Model: P51-2000-A-AD-I12-4.5V-000-000
  • Input Voltage: 4.5V
  • Output: Analog signal
  • Operating Temperature Range: -40°C to 125°C
  • Pressure Range: 0-2000 psi
  • Accuracy: ±0.5%

Working Principles

The P51-2000-A-AD-I12-4.5V-000-000 operates on the principle of strain gauge technology, where changes in pressure cause deformation in the sensing element, resulting in a corresponding change in electrical resistance. This change is then converted into an analog output signal proportional to the applied pressure.
